Mesothelioma Lawyers

A mesothelioma lawyer can help you to understand your legal options and bring a lawsuit. They can help you understand the process of asbestos trust funds to ensure you are compensated.

There are many types of mesothelioma claims. The type you choose will affect important details like deadlines. Lawyers who have experience can help determine if you're eligible for these funds and manage the legal process.

A lawyer can help with claims for wrongful death in addition to lawsuits against negligent asbestos producers. These lawsuits seek compensation for the loss of a loved one's loss due to m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ses. These lawsuits may be filed by the victim's spouse or children, as well as other family members.

Contingency fees

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ma can offer an array of fees including contingency. These fees are based on the outcome of the lawsuit and are an amount of the total amount of compensation awarded. A mesothelioma attorney should be in a position to provide a detailed explanation of the fee structure.
